Hi Mark! No offense meant. But are you an analyst?

The argument that you presented for buying AMD shares is similar to an argument I listened to in the summer of 1995. Unfortunately, I bought AMD shares, only to see them sink, because AMD could not actually produce what it promised that it would produce.

So in 1995, I wrote off a tax loss of several thousand dollars in AMD shares. I would be very careful before I invested in that company again.

Even if they do make a chip similar to Intel's, you have to wonder how reliable it will be. Reliability has become a critical issue for me because Windows 95 keeps crashing.

So please be careful, when investing in a company that is bringing a new product to market.
